Josef Kroupa
1894–1944 (age 50)
Biography
Josef Kroupa entered the world in 1894 and came of age as the Austro-Hungarian Empire waned, witnessing the birth of Czechoslovakia and the uncertain years that followed. His adult life was shaped by both the promise of a new republic and the shadow of wartime occupation.
He died in 1944 and is buried at Brno Central Cemetery, his life remembered as part of the generation that stood between eras of history.
